Germany started the match as favourites, given the amount of quality they had in their squad. But talent isn't everything as Joachim Loew's men found out the hard way this morning (Singapore time), after crashing out of Euro 2012 with a 2-1 loss to Italy.
It wasn't so much the choice of the system used, but the personnel Loew picked to start the game, as Toni Kroos fared miserably in the semi-final. Defensive mistakes also led to the Germans' downfall, which was sealed with two brilliant Mario Balotelli goals.
